Transaction 113973642b1b382697925a344b08d66e0452ffaed59abb4dbba243dde6f3b08a
1 Input
1 Output
-
113973642b1b382697925a344b08d66e0452ffaed59abb4dbba243dde6f3b08a:0
- value
- 5155856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c97967fdce6745e274ec0a4936574f57d5d5444 OP_EQUAL
- address
- 34JCSRfpGucmmeKBS2RyHptZxGcwXsG3Ge